The operational parameters listed on the System Status page are shown in a tabular format. The
first (left) column identifies the parameter categories:

• Satellite Interface – Contains information on the receive status and signal strength, as well

as error messages related to satellite modem receive information.

• Administrative States – Contains information on software downloads to this satellite modem,

security keys, and other administrative functions.
